Kinds Of L1 Visas

Several sorts of L1 visas satisfy the varied needs of multinational companies aiming to move staff members to the United States. The two primary groups of L1 visas are L1A and L1B, each created for certain functions and duties within an organization. L1 Visa Requirements.The L1A visa is planned for supervisors and executives. This category allows business to move people that hold managerial or executive positions, enabling them to supervise procedures in the united state. This visa is valid for a preliminary duration of approximately 3 years, with the opportunity of extensions for a total amount of up to seven years. The L1A visa is particularly helpful for business looking for to establish a strong management presence in the united state market.On the other hand, the L1B visa is marked for workers with specialized knowledge. This includes individuals who have sophisticated competence in details locations, such as exclusive modern technologies or one-of-a-kind processes within the company. The L1B visa is also legitimate for a preliminary three-year period, with expansions readily available for as much as 5 years. This visa group is optimal for firms that call for staff members with specialized skills to enhance their operations and keep an one-upmanship in the U.S.Both L1A and L1B visas enable for double intent, suggesting that visa holders can apply for long-term residency while on the visa. Understanding the distinctions between these 2 categories is essential for companies planning to browse the complexities of worker transfers to the United States successfully
Eligibility Demands
To get an L1 visa, both the company and the staff member need to satisfy certain eligibility standards established by U.S. immigration authorities. The L1 visa is developed for intra-company transferees, allowing international business to transfer employees to their united state offices.First, the company must be a qualifying company, which means it has to have a moms and dad business, branch, subsidiary, or associate that is working both in the U.S. and in the foreign nation. This relationship is vital for showing that the worker is being moved within the exact same business structure. The employer should likewise have been doing company for at the very least one year in both locations.Second, the employee has to have been used by the foreign company for a minimum of one continuous year within the three years coming before the application. This employment must remain in a supervisory, exec, or specialized understanding capacity. For L1A visas, which satisfy managers and executives, the worker must show that they will certainly remain to operate in a comparable capacity in the united state For L1B visas, meant for employees with specialized expertise, the private have to possess one-of-a-kind competence that contributes substantially to the firm's procedures.
Application Process
Steering the application procedure for an L1 visa includes numerous vital actions that must be completed properly to guarantee a successful outcome. The very first step is to determine the proper classification of the L1 visa: L1A for managers and executives, or L1B for staff members with specialized expertise. This distinction is considerable, as it impacts the documents required.Once the classification is recognized, the U.S. company must submit Form I-129, Request for a Nonimmigrant Employee. This type ought to include in-depth information concerning the business, the worker's function, and the nature of the work to be performed in the united state Accompanying paperwork typically includes proof of the relationship between the united state and foreign entities, proof of the staff member's credentials, and information concerning the task offer.After submission, the united state Citizenship and Immigration Provider (USCIS) will examine the application. If authorized, the staff member will certainly be notified, and they can after that obtain the visa at a united state consulate or embassy in their home nation. This includes completing Kind DS-160, the Online Nonimmigrant copyright, and arranging an interview.During the meeting, the applicant should provide numerous papers, consisting of the authorized Type I-129, evidence of work, and any kind of extra supporting proof. Following the meeting, if the visa is provided, the staff member will certainly receive a visa stamp in their key, permitting them to go into the united state to help the funding company. Correct prep work and extensive documents are essential to maneuvering this process effectively.

Usual Challenges
While the L1 visa supplies countless advantages for multinational firms and their staff members, it is not without its obstacles. One notable difficulty is the rigorous documentation and eligibility requirements enforced by the U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Provider (USCIS) Companies should give thorough proof of the foreign employee's qualifications, the nature of the organization, and the qualifying partnership in between the united state and foreign entities. This procedure can be time-consuming and may require lawful know-how to browse successfully.Another difficulty is the potential for analysis throughout the petition procedure. USCIS officers may examine the legitimacy of the company procedures or the worker's role within the organization. This analysis can bring about delays or also denials of the copyright, which can greatly influence the business's functional strategies and the staff member's career trajectory.Furthermore, the L1 visa is tied to the sponsoring employer, which indicates that job modifications can complicate the visa status. If an L1 visa owner desires to switch employers, they must commonly seek a different visa classification, which can include intricacy to their immigration journey.Lastly, keeping conformity with L1 visa regulations is important. Companies should guarantee that their employee's role aligns with the first petition and that the organization proceeds to fulfill the eligibility requirements. Failing to do so can result in abrogation of the visa, impacting both the employee and the organization. These challenges necessitate detailed preparation and recurring management to guarantee a successful L1 visa experience.

Can Family Members Accompany L1 Visa Holders?
Yes, member of the family can go along with L1 visa holders. Partners and unmarried kids under 21 years old are qualified for L2 visas, which allow them to live and examine in the United States throughout the L1 owner's remain.
Just How Lengthy Can L1 Visa Owners Remain In the U.S.?
L1 visa holders can originally remain in the U.S. for up to 3 years (L1 Visa). This period may be expanded, enabling a maximum stay of 7 years for L1A visa holders and 5 years for L1B visa owners
